Output d8d63d23c2d364fa37c250306aada448d96d3e31314265d5dcee66e6493ab4fd:51

value
126085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58bec249c123e4ea427ed9b5645cc18f99551f76 OP_EQUAL
address
39nFub4x2Ls4qMqKVAjt5AVa13TuxBUya1
transaction
d8d63d23c2d364fa37c250306aada448d96d3e31314265d5dcee66e6493ab4fd
spent
true